Boykin Mill

Boykin Mill is a historic gristmill near Boykin in Kershaw County, South Carolina, built around 1905 and powered by water. It forms part of the Boykin Mill Complex, a historic district containing industrial, residential, and community structures associated with the area's development. Bear's Mill

Bear’s Mill is a historic watermill constructed in 1849 and located near Greenville, Ohio. It represents the oldest surviving industrial building within Darke County. The mill originally ground grain into flour for local residents and farmers. Today, it serves as a historical site and educational resource, attracting those interested in early American industry and rural heritage.
